Output d57e58309c7fc88df253964c49650ab2e45c1abe91dd5160756d324d38a1d95c:1

value
27175662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c76b91138ca4306aa5d6b35b7cc2a8d6b4dc2aef OP_EQUAL
address
3KsTFaohixYDqfAkur8k6yXbKbmMF3G74u
transaction
d57e58309c7fc88df253964c49650ab2e45c1abe91dd5160756d324d38a1d95c
spent
true